Ms K Arnold v Nikki Marks Ltd (England and Wales : Redundancy) [2024] UKET 3200669/2024 (12 September 2024)

Ms K Arnold v Nikki Marks Ltd (England and Wales : Redundancy) [2024] UKET 3200669/2024 (12 September 2024)

The tribunal found that the dismissal was a genuine redundancy and that the respondent followed the required procedures.
